What the Book Is About
My first impression was that this is not just a historical account, but a deeply personal reflection from someone who lived through an unforgettable moment in American history. Clint Hill, who served as a Secret Service agent, shares his perspective on the five days surrounding the assassination of President John F. Kennedy. I found that the book offers both emotional depth and historical significance.
